Spring 2026–Present

Undergraduate Researcher

NYU GRAIL

Researching embodied robot intelligence at NYU's Generalizable Robotics and Artificial Intelligence Lab under Professor Lerrel Pinto, with interests in robot dexterity, full-body mobile platforms, and expressive bipeds.

My contribution
  • Reinforced and tested RUKA-v2 hand and wrist hardware while running teleoperation experiments and contributing inverse-kinematics calculations and retargeting.
  • Leads aesthetics for YOR v3 while implementing charging-dock mechanics, dock electronics, and dock-detection charging safety in preparation for a consumer-ready platform.
  • Contributes to BEBOP's physical design, URDF development, and reinforcement-learning policy experiments.
Team / project outcomes
  • RUKA-v2 was released as published open-source research by the project team.
  • YOR v3 and BEBOP remain active lab projects; YOR v3 is being developed toward a consumer-ready release.
  • BEBOP has begun its sim-to-real journey: its policies work in simulation, while the physical robot can currently stand but does not yet walk.

Spring–Summer 2025

Robotics Intern

Rose City Robotics

Worked across autonomous navigation, simulation-driven development, and technical representation for a robotics company.

My contribution
  • Developed SLAM-based robotics systems on the TurtleBot Waffle Pi platform.
  • Built simulated training environments with NVIDIA Isaac Sim and Isaac Lab.
  • Represented Rose City Robotics at the 2025 Oregon Innovation Showcase, speaking with other entrepreneurs and potential investors.
  • Helped shape an introductory robotics course that would expose younger students to methods emerging at the frontiers of the robotics industry.
  • Expanded the startup's outreach to local high-school students and Portland-area Asian American communities through relationships and community channels developed while growing up Chinese American in the area.
Team / project outcomes
  • The internship supported the company's robotics development and public technical demonstration work.
  • Rose City Robotics launched the course concept as a free summer program for middle-school students and later expanded it into the AI Robotics Sprint for intermediate roboticists entering policy training.
